atferdsnormer
Atferdsnormer, often translated as behavioral norms, are unwritten rules or expectations that guide how individuals in a society or group are expected to behave. These norms are learned through socialization and observation, and they play a crucial role in maintaining social order and facilitating predictable interactions. They can vary significantly across different cultures, subcultures, and even specific social settings.
